ARQUIMEA is a technology company operating globally and providing innovative solutions and products in highly demanding sectors.

Our areas of activity include Aerospace, Defense & Security, Big Science, Biotechnology, and Fintech.

ARQUIMEA SPACE develops spaceflight parts and equipment for satellites and launchers. We specialize in thermal control systems, structural panels, optical payloads, avionics, release and deployment mechanisms, and rad-hard microelectronics. Together with our tech partners, we provide high-throughput smallsats and their subsystems. Our brand-new factory in Madrid is suited to integrate satellites and constellations.

We are looking for a Senior Mechanical Engineer to take responsibility for leading the technical development cycle of mechanical structures for satellites, including satellite constellations, covering all the product lifecycle from conception to serial production.

Tasks to be performed:

  • Understand user/market needs and produce detailed technical specifications accordingly.
  • Technical leadership on mechanical structures development projects.
  • Define technical development strategies, in close collaboration with Project Managers and the technical team.
  • Define top-level architectures and interfaces for the products under development.
  • Coordinate the technical development with specialists in different engineering areas and identify cross-area needs.
  • Coordinate key technical designs and analyses.
  • Define technical strategies and requirements focused on a design to build philosophy oriented to high production, assembly, and testing ratios.
  • Complete trade-offs and preliminary concept designs, feasibility analyses, identify critical areas and prepare plans for mitigation.
  • Lead project technical design, analysis, production, verification, and validation during development.
  • Author clear and concise technical reports and processes, demonstrating a clear understanding of design, manufacturing, and testing.
  • Support test campaigns and definition of early prototypes for validation (stress, thermal, radiation, electrical, manufacturing, test, etc.) according to space standards.
  • Develop and maintain excellent customer working relationships.
  • Communicate with stakeholders to identify potential needs and requirements.
  • Assist in preparation of technical elements for bids and proposals.

Required skills, experience, and candidate profile:

  • Degree in an engineering discipline (Mechanical, Aerospace, Industrial...) with relevant experience in the Space industry.
  • At least 10 years’ proven experience working in the aerospace industry.
  • Systems Engineering lifecycle knowledge and experience.
  • Experience leading development plans for mechanical systems.
  • Hands-on design experience of 3D CAD tools (SolidWorks) and other engineering tools.
  • Experience with Finite Element Method. Experience with Nastran/Patran will be highly valued.
  • Experience with different analyses tools, such as kinematic analyses tools, data analysis, etc. is desirable.
  • Experience in verification and validation processes, including environmental and functional testing.
  • Experience in MAIT campaigns at satellite or system level.
  • Ability to work independently and lead a multi-disciplinary technical team.
  • Excellent analytical and problem-solving skills.
  • Excellent interpersonal skills, including presentation and communication.
  • Fluency in English and Spanish.
